Listing 4 full-circle rings which are in the lieutenancy area of Northamptonshire, have 5 bells and no semitone bells, and are unringable. Click on place name for fuller details.

1 Broughton, Northamptonshire, S Andrew (T).
5 U/R, 10 cwt (~510 kg) in A. One bell (or more) from ring hung for swing chiming with levers: 2nd; unringable.
SP837757 Map
2 Chelveston, Northamptonshire, S John Bapt.
5 U/R, 8 cwt (~410 kg) in A. Unringable.
SP988691 Map
3 Farthinghoe, Northamptonshire, S Michael & All Angels (GF).
5 U/R, 11 cwt (~560 kg) in G♯. Unringable; anticlockwise.
SP536397 Map
4 Old, Northamptonshire, S Andrew (GF;T).
5 U/R, 12 cwt (~610 kg) in F♯. Unringable.
